ASTM F2374-22 is the primary safety standard for inflatable amusement devices in the U.S., outlining design and testing criteria. EN14960 is the European standard covering structural integrity and anchoring for commercial use. Safety certifications in commercial bounce houses ensure equipment meets recognized manufacturing and operational requirements before deployment.
Commercial inflatables are constructed using 15-20 oz/yd² PVC vinyl (0.55-0.7 mm thick) for durability under high-frequency use. Triple stitching means reinforced seams for exceptional durability at stress points. Heat welding ensures an airtight and waterproof construction essential for maintaining proper inflation during extended operation.

Venue factors include available square footage, ceiling height for indoor locations, power supply access, and ground surface composition. Outdoor setups require level grass or concrete areas measuring at least 20x30 feet for standard obstacle courses. Indoor venues must provide 12-15 foot ceiling clearance and nearby electrical outlets for blower operation.
Ground anchoring requirements differ between grass surfaces using metal stakes and concrete areas requiring sandbag weights. Urban venues with limited outdoor space often necessitate compact combo units rather than full-length obstacle courses. Accessibility for delivery trucks affects equipment selection within gated communities or apartment complexes.

Weather planning requires monitoring forecasts 48-72 hours before events and establishing clear cancellation or postponement policies with rental companies. Backup indoor locations or tent coverings provide contingency options when rain threatens outdoor setups. Wind speeds exceeding 25 mph create unsafe operating conditions requiring equipment deflation.
Space constraints necessitate precise measurements accounting for safety perimeters around inflatable units and guest circulation areas. Minimum clearance of 3-5 feet on all sides prevents collisions with structures or landscaping. Venue site inspections before booking confirm adequate dimensions and identify potential obstacles affecting equipment placement.

Rental cost evaluation begins with comparing base rates across multiple providers serving your geographic area. Classic bounce rental costs $75-$125 per day versus purchase prices of $899-$1,800. Water slide rental ranges $150-$420 per day versus purchase costs of $5,995-$6,690.
Combo unit rental costs $295-$400 per day versus purchase prices of $3,595-$5,995. Luxury custom rental ranges $400-$750+ per day versus purchase costs of $6,000-$25,000+. Setup and delivery fees typically add $25-$50 per event beyond base rental rates.
Set-up considerations require confirming that rental companies provide proof of insurance and ASTM compliance documentation before event dates. Verify venues have adequate space, power supply access, and secure anchoring points for safe installation. Metal D-rings provide secure anchoring systems preventing equipment displacement during active use.
Professional setup teams should arrive 60-90 minutes before party start times to complete installation and safety checks. Operators must demonstrate proper blower operation and emergency deflation procedures to responsible adults. Clear safety guidelines regarding maximum capacity, age restrictions, and prohibited activities should accompany every rental agreement.

Maximizing fun and safety requires establishing clear supervision protocols and communicating rules before children access inflatable equipment. Assign dedicated adult monitors maintaining constant visual oversight of all activity zones throughout the event. These kids' party planning 2026 strategies ensure responsible adults remain alert to potential hazards without participating in play activities.
Enforce manufacturer capacity limits even when children request exceptions to prevent overloading and structural stress. Maintain first aid supplies and emergency contact information in accessible locations throughout the party venue. Brief all supervising adults on emergency deflation procedures and injury response protocols before guests arrive.
Essential supervision measures include maintaining minimum adult-to-child ratios of 1:10 for obstacle course activities and positioning supervisors with clear sightlines. Adults must actively monitor rather than socialize, watching for risky behaviors like flips or collisions. Establish ground rules prohibiting roughhousing, food consumption, and running near entrance areas before allowing access.
Commercial PVC can support up to 2,000 lbs, while residential units support only 200-400 lbs capacity. Enforce weight and age restrictions, preventing equipment overload and ensuring appropriate challenge levels. Immediately remove children exhibiting dangerous behaviors and explain safety violations to prevent repeated incidents.
Maintaining inflatable integrity requires continuous blower operation throughout events and periodic visual inspections for air pressure consistency. Monitor anchor points every 30-60 minutes, ensuring stakes or weights remain secure despite ground vibration. Check entrance and exit areas for debris accumulation that could cause trips or punctures.
Inspect seams and high-stress areas for unusual wear or separation, indicating potential structural problems. Address minor air leaks immediately by adjusting blower settings or repositioning equipment away from sharp objects. Keep emergency contact information for rental companies accessible if technical problems exceed on-site troubleshooting capabilities.
Weather issue protocols require monitoring wind speeds and suspending operation when gusts exceed 25 mph. Lightning within 10 miles necessitates immediate evacuation and equipment deflation until storms pass. Rain creates slippery surfaces requiring temporary suspension until moisture evaporates and conditions stabilize.
Technical issues like blower malfunctions or unexpected deflation require immediate guest evacuation and rental company notification. Keep backup entertainment options available for weather delays, including indoor games or rescheduled activity sequences. Clear communication with parents about weather-related modifications manages expectations and maintains positive event experiences despite disruptions.
